Suppurative inflammation of the sper- matic cord of a horse sometimes following castration. ehancre (shang’ker) [Fr.]. The primary lesion of syphilis. fun gating c., soft chancre, characterized by fungoid granulations. hard c., Hunter i an c., indurated c., true c., a constitutional venereal sore, followed by true syphilis. Its base and sides are distinctly hard, and it gives off a thin secretion that produces syphilis when inoculated upon another person. mixed c., an alleged form of soft chancre which is followed by constitutional syphilis. Nisbet’s c., nodular absce es in the penis after acute lymphangitis from soft chancre. non-infecting c. " simple c., soft c. See chanroid. Ricord’s c., the parchment-like initial lesion of syphilis.
